the tyra show





We had the most... interesting and fun experience at the Tyra Banks show this week. Casey got us tickets and it was so fun and crazy!

I was mostly surprised by how fake it was. After getting us all seated on the set (front row!!), they filmed the audience doing different reactions. They told us our reactions could be inserted into multiple shows over the whole season.

"Okay, now you're surprised. Ready, NOW."
And they filmed us being surprised for a few seconds, then,
"Now you're really excited, pretend Tyra just walked in, stand up and go crazy!"
"Okay, now everyone nod like you agree with something that was just said."
"Now shake your heads no."
"Okay, bigger head shake, like you really disagree."

It was so odd. Finally Tyra came out and acted like a diva with her tiny waist and huge eyes and wig (probably). We acted ultra interested and surprised and delighted and whatever else they wanted us to be for the camera. It was kind of tiring! But the whole thing was just such an experience. You know?
